Marketing your art starts with a plan
Your plan starts with determining your "MISSION" (what you want to accomplish from art marketing), and defining and articulating your "VISION" ( values; preferred future; where I am going).

For example, if you were planning a road trip, your mission would be to arrive at a destination, and your vision might include how you would get there and what fun you would have upon arrival.
Your art marketing plan is personal and unique to your Vision & Mission, but has some common elements:
- Artist Marketing Objectives (what you want to accomplish)
- Artist Marketing Goals (the steps needed to accomplish the objectives)
- An Art Marketing Time Line (when to accomplish the steps)

Artist Promotional Materials
All artist promotional materials should consistently exhibit your "brand". Content, style, unique attributes.
Printed Artist Promotional Materials for Hand-out & Snail Mail
- a brief artists statement (in terms of your marketing objectives)
- an artist resume of accomplishments
- an artist biography
- an Artist Marketing Brochure and thumbnail art portfolio
